The pedal mode is switched by pressing and holding the MODE button on the front of the steering wheel base. The wheel is able to do this really simply, and unfortunately can happen accidentally. When you do this the gas and clutch signals need to be swapped. The pedals on some Thrustmaster wheels can be flipped upside-down so the pedals hang. When reversing the accelerator pedal acts as a brake.įS22 might change this as it introduces gears, which if set to manual might mean you can allocate a reverse gear and have the throttle and brake pedals act normally - there also appears to be a use for clutches. With this disabled you'll have to lift off the brake and then redepress it to reverse. The brake is also the reverse, but in the in-game "Game Settings" (the escape menu ones) you can disable "Stop and Go Braking", which will stop the vehicle from automatically reversing if you hold the brake pedal down. If you go to the game options (not the ones in the escape menu but the ones on the main menu), go across to "Keyboard Controls" (the third icon) then at the bottom, next to "Back" and "Reset" choose GamePad (or wheel or whatever yours says) and you can set your own controls in there. I assume you don't anyway if you've got the T-LCM pedals, but it's worth checking as that is the default for the regular T300. I've sold my T300 so I can't check it (I had the T3PA pedals anyway), but make sure your pedals aren't set to combined mode in the Thrustmaster Control Panel (this means if you accelerate and brake at the same time they cancel each other out).
